Understanding the Psychology of Progression

The psychological factors at play in the chicken road game are surprisingly complex. Initial success breeds confidence, leading individuals to underestimate the probability of future failure. This phenomenon, known as the illusion of control, encourages continued participation, even as the stakes escalate. Each successful step reinforces the belief that one is skilled at navigating the challenges, fostering a sense of invulnerability. However, this feeling is often misleading, as luck plays a significant role, and unforeseen events can quickly reverse fortunes. A crucial element is loss aversion – the tendency to feel the pain of a loss more acutely than the pleasure of an equivalent gain. This bias can lead to irrational decisions, such as continuing to play in an attempt to recoup previous losses, a behavior commonly seen in gambling.

The Role of Cognitive Biases

Beyond the illusion of control and loss aversion, several other cognitive biases influence decision-making in similar scenarios. Framing effects, where the way information is presented impacts choices, can be powerful. Presenting the potential gains as a percentage increase rather than a monetary amount can make the risk seem more acceptable. Confirmation bias, the tendency to seek out information that confirms existing beliefs, can lead individuals to dismiss warning signs and focus only on positive indicators. Furthermore, the sunk cost fallacy—investing more time, energy, or money into something because you have already invested heavily in it, even if it’s failing—compels continued involvement despite declining prospects. Recognizing these biases is the first step toward making more rational, objective decisions.

The Mathematical Foundation of Optimal Stopping

The chicken road game is a classic example of an optimal stopping problem, a concept studied extensively in mathematics and economics. The underlying principle involves finding the point at which the expected benefit of continuing to play is less than the expected benefit of stopping and securing current winnings. The optimal strategy doesn't necessarily involve maximizing the expected value at each step, but rather maximizing the long-term average outcome. This often requires making difficult choices, such as stopping even when you are on a winning streak, if the probability of losing increases significantly. The math behind this can become quite complex, involving concepts like probability distributions and expected utility, but the core idea remains the same: finding the right balance between exploration (continuing to play) and exploitation (stopping to secure gains).
